Premier League outfit Leeds United will be in a strong position to sign Nottingham Forest winger Brennan Johnson if they remain afloat in the top tier and the Welshman’s current side remain in the Championship, according to the view of journalist Dean Jones who spoke to Give Me Sport.
Leeds United are still embroiled in a ding dong relegation battle with Everton and Burnley in the Premier League, with two sides already down, one of those three will be dropping to the Championship.
